Home
last modified time | relevance | path

Searched refs:ScalarLoad (Results 1 – 4 of 4)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/CodeGen/SelectionDAG/
H A DDAGCombiner.cpp22011 auto *ScalarLoad = dyn_cast<LoadSDNode>(Scalar); in combineInsertEltToLoad() local
22012 if (!ScalarLoad) in combineInsertEltToLoad()
22025 int EltSize = ScalarLoad->getValueType(0).getScalarSizeInBits(); in combineInsertEltToLoad()
22026 if (EltSize == 0 || EltSize % 8 != 0 || !ScalarLoad->isSimple() || in combineInsertEltToLoad()
22028 ScalarLoad->getExtensionType() != ISD::NON_EXTLOAD || in combineInsertEltToLoad()
22029 ScalarLoad->getAddressSpace() != VecLoad->getAddressSpace()) in combineInsertEltToLoad()
22035 if (!DAG.areNonVolatileConsecutiveLoads(ScalarLoad, VecLoad, EltSize / 8, in combineInsertEltToLoad()
22040 VecLoad, ScalarLoad, VT.getVectorNumElements() * EltSize / 8, -1)) in combineInsertEltToLoad()
22056 SDValue Ptr = ScalarLoad->getBasePtr(); in combineInsertEltToLoad()
22061 InsIndex == 0 ? ScalarLoad->getPointerInfo() in combineInsertEltToLoad()
[all …]
H A DTargetLowering.cpp9690 SDValue ScalarLoad = in scalarizeVectorLoad() local
9698 Vals.push_back(ScalarLoad.getValue(0)); in scalarizeVectorLoad()
9699 LoadChains.push_back(ScalarLoad.getValue(1)); in scalarizeVectorLoad()
/freebsd/contrib/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VISelLowering.cpp9442 SDValue ScalarLoad = in LowerINTRINSIC_W_CHAIN()
9445 Chain = ScalarLoad.getValue(1); in LowerINTRINSIC_W_CHAIN()
9446 Result = lowerScalarSplat(SDValue(), ScalarLoad, VL, ContainerVT, DL, DAG, in LowerINTRINSIC_W_CHAIN()
9449 SDValue ScalarLoad = DAG.getLoad(ScalarVT, DL, Load->getChain(), Ptr, in LowerINTRINSIC_W_CHAIN()
9451 Chain = ScalarLoad.getValue(1); in LowerINTRINSIC_W_CHAIN()
9452 Result = DAG.getSplat(ContainerVT, DL, ScalarLoad); in LowerINTRINSIC_W_CHAIN()
9440 SDValue ScalarLoad = LowerINTRINSIC_W_CHAIN() local
9447 SDValue ScalarLoad = DAG.getLoad(ScalarVT, DL, Load->getChain(), Ptr, LowerINTRINSIC_W_CHAIN() local
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86ISelLowering.cpp51484 if (SDValue ScalarLoad = in combineMaskedLoad() local
51486 return ScalarLoad; in combineMaskedLoad()